2. Why people move here
El Salvador has gone from cautionary tale to one of Central America's most talked-about destinations: a USD economy, Bitcoin as legal tender, a booming "Surf City" tourism push along the Pacific (El Zonte / La Libertad), and a dramatic fall in violent crime since 2022. For founders and crypto-natives it's uniquely welcoming.
The honest catch: the safety turnaround came via a "state of exception" that raises civil-liberties concerns; the headline Freedom Visa requires a very large (~$1M in BTC/USDT) contribution. Daily government life is in Spanish.

4. Tax, Money & Banking
- Tax: Territorial β foreign-source income generally untaxed; local income taxed. Bitcoin gains exempt under its legal-tender framework.
- Treaties: no comprehensive CA/US income tax treaty; USD economy simplifies money handling.
- Banking: Moderate; USD accounts; crypto-friendly infrastructure unusually developed.
5. Cost of Living
- Single comfortable $1,000β1,600/mo; coastal surf towns and San Salvador's nicer districts cost more.
- Rent (1BR): San Salvador ~$400β800; El Zonte/La Libertad beach rentals higher.
6. Safety
- Massively improved β homicide rates fell dramatically after 2022. Tourist and expat zones are now considered safe. Note the civil-liberties trade-offs of the security policy; check current advisories.
7. Healthcare
- Private hospitals in San Salvador are adequate; expat insurance affordable. Complex care may go to the US.
8. Property & Airbnb / STR
- Foreigners can own property. Surf-coast real estate is in a boom; San Salvador offers urban options.
- STR yields ~8β12% on the surf coast and capital, riding the tourism push; verify local rules.
